Check which version you've been running before, then read below for the necessary changes. +* Priorities: +------------- +(Affected: 0.5.x and older) + +The server-side setting "Suspend behaviour" has been dropped in 0.6.0 in favour +of priority based precedence. A priority of 0 and above means that clients +have precedence. A negative priority gives precedence to local live TV on the +server. So if "Suspend behaviour" was previously set to "Client may suspend" or +"Never suspended", you will have to configure a negative priority. If the +"Suspend behaviour" was set to "Always suspended", the default values should do. + +Configure the desired priorities for HTTP and IGMP Multicast streaming in the +settings of streamdev-server. If you haven't updated all your streamdev-clients +to at least 0.5.2, configure "Legacy Client Priority", too. + +In streamdev-client, you should set "Minimum Priority" to -99. Adjust "Live TV +Priority" if necessary. + * Location of files: -------------------- (Affected: 0.3.x, 0.4.x, 0.4.0pre, 0.5.0pre) diff --git a/common.c b/common.c index edddd20..4ac7c6f 100644 --- a/common.c +++ b/common.c @@ -10,7 +10,7 @@ using namespace std; -const char *VERSION = "0.5.2-git"; +const char *VERSION = "0.6.0-git"; const char cMenuEditIpItem::IpCharacters[] = "0123456789.";
